Autumn Roasted Vegetables in the company of Apples and Pecans

The perfect fall margin dish! This seasonal, colorful roasted veggie mix includes Brussels sprouts, red onion, butternut squash, apples. It's seasoned in the company of spices and lemon and you'll love the addition on crunch pecans and munch cranberries. Such a luscious recipe!
Servings: 5
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 1 hour
  • 16 oz brussels sprouts, bottoms trimmed, halved (discard loose leaves)
  • 1/2 medium red onion, diced into small chunks
  • 4 Tbsp salted butter, melted, divided
  • 1 Tbsp fresh lemon juice
  • Salt
  • 3 cups cubed butternut squash (diced into 3/4-inch pieces)
  • 2 medium firm baking apples*
  • 2 Tbsp packed light dark sugar
  • 1/4 tsp 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 tsp ground nutmeg
  • 2/3 cup pecans (whole or forcefully chopped)
  • 1/3 cup dried cranberries
  1. Preheat stove to 400 degrees. Spray a rimmed 18 by 13-inch baking bed linen in the company of non-stick cooking spray.
  2. Add Brussels sprouts and red onions to a large mixing bowl. Pour 2 Tbsp butter over of} top while well while 1 Tbsp lemon juice, throw at the same time as seasoning in the company of seasoning to flavour (about 1/4 tsp).
  3. Transfer to baking bed linen and spread out across pan. Add squash and apples to same mixing bowl.
  4. Pour remaining 2 Tbsp butter over of} top and toss, then sprinkle dark sugar, cinnamon, nutmeg and seasoning (about 1/4 tsp) over of} top and throw to evenly coat.
  5. Transfer to baking bed linen and spread into an stable film (just around Brussels sprouts and onions).
  6. Roast in preheated oven, tossing once to the midpoint via baking, till Brussels sprouts have browned a bit and squash is soft, at the same time as sprinkling pecans and cranberries over of} top during the last 3 record on baking, about 40 record total. Serve warm.
  • *I suggest using only sugary and only tart apple. I used only Tango apple and only Granny Smith apple. Honey Crisp, Braeburn, Cortland, Jonathan or Rome Beauty should be employed here while well, yet keep in mind they won't have that same rosey color.
